Silica-Free Sandblasting Abrasive

Silica-free sandblasting is a reliable, industry-standard abrasive blasting method used for aggressive surface preparation where durability and cutting power are required.

silica free sand for sandblastingUnlike traditional silica sand, silica-free blasting media significantly reduces health risks while delivering consistent, effective results across a wide range of industrial and commercial applications.

This type of sandblasting is well suited for removing heavy rust, thick coatings, and deeply embedded surface contamination. It is commonly used when a strong surface profile is needed for repairs, coatings, or refinishing.

Common Silica-Free Sandblasting Applications

Silica-free sandblasting is used across many industries and surface types, including:

Heavy Rust and Thick Paint Removal
Removes severe rust, scale, and multiple layers of paint from steel and metal surfaces.

Concrete and Pipe Cleaning
Cleans concrete, pipes, and structural components by removing buildup, coatings, and surface contamination.

Metal Frame and Structural Stripping
Strips metal frames, beams, and fabricated components in preparation for repair or recoating.

Industrial and Farm Equipment
Restores heavy equipment by removing corrosion, grease buildup, and failed coatings.

Boats and Watercraft
Used on steel and aluminum marine components where strong rust and coating removal is required.

Surface Preparation for Long-Term Performance

In addition to cleaning, silica-free sandblasting creates a strong surface profile that improves adhesion for paints, coatings, and protective finishes. Proper profiling is essential for ensuring coatings bond correctly and perform over the long term, especially in industrial and marine environments.

By using silica-free sandblasting media, surfaces are prepared efficiently while maintaining a safer work environment and consistent results.
